Comenzando con Python en SublimeText

Cuando SublimeREPL da problemas con la sentencia input()


Entorno:

  • S.O.: Windows 10 64 bits.
  • Intérprete de Python: 3.10 (64 bits).
  • Entorno de edición: Sublime Text 3 (build 4126)

 

 

Siguiendo los pasos del gran gurú de Píldoras (aunque con unos años de retraso) me encuentro con el problema de las nuevas versiones.

Instalado en Sublime el dichoso REPL, al probar la instrucción input() de Python, resulta que la consola de Sublime no le pasa los datos (o algo así, parece ser).

Después de rebuscar mucho por ahí, encontramos que la solución pasa por editar el archivo Main.sublime-menu ubicado en la ruta: C:\Users\%user%\AppData\Roaming\Sublime Text\Packages\SublimeREPL\config\Python

Localizado el archivo, hay que editar y añadir en cmd $file_basename tal y como aparece en la captura:

Con todo esto, queda solucionado y podemos continuar con los videos. Así ya podemos ejecutar en la consola integrada en el Sublime Text.

Post: Siendo que al reiniciar la máquina ha vuelto a dejar de funcionar, desisto. Me paso a otro editor. He aquí la solución:



No hay comentarios: